Issue
On certain vacuum excavator trucks, the hydraulic dump body cylinder could corrode at the threaded joint, causing it to fail. If this occurs during a dump cycle, the dump body could unexpectedly move and create a risk of injury. Correction: Dealers will repair or replace the hydraulic dump body cylinder as necessary.
